The premise

Every life is the sum of its decisions. Each episode takes one real choice apart — the pressure around it, the alternatives, and what it cost — until the reasoning is visible rather than assumed.

Who it’s for

For anyone standing at a fork and wanting better questions before they answer. No formulas, no five-step frameworks.

Format and cadence

Long-form conversation, two hosts, one guest. Roughly an hour, unhurried, published weekly.

Bianca Criaco

Wellness educator, Pilates instructor and advocate

Bianca Criaco is a wellness educator, Pilates instructor and advocate whose work is shaped by both professional knowledge and lived experience. Having navigated profound personal challenges, including domestic violence, substance dependence and cancer, she is passionate about helping others recognise their capacity to create meaningful change.

Her advocacy focuses on raising awareness of domestic violence, substance dependence and suicide prevention. Through education, movement and authentic storytelling, Bianca aims to encourage others to broaden their perspectives, strengthen their wellbeing and recognise that they have greater agency than they may realise.

Outside her professional work, Bianca embraces adventure and believes joy is an essential part of a meaningful life. Whether she’s riding her motorcycle, electric skateboarding, surfing or laughing with the people she loves, she believes that while life presents profound challenges, we don’t always have to take ourselves too seriously. Her hope is to inspire others not only to overcome adversity, but to build a life lived authentically, with connection, purpose and joy.

Mariah

Property specialist and psychology student

Mariah is of Samoan and English heritage, originally from Tamborine Mountain and now based on the Gold Coast, Australia. She has spent the past eight years working in the property industry, helping first home buyers achieve the dream of home ownership, while studying a Bachelor of Psychological Science with the goal of supporting people affected by religious trauma and the lasting impact of high-control groups.

Raised in a high-control religion, Mariah spent her late teens and early twenties preaching full-time while trying to reconcile her beliefs, identity and sexuality before making the life-changing choice to leave at 30. Leaving behind the beliefs, community and most of the relationships she had always known sparked a deep curiosity about belief and human behaviour, inspiring her to pursue psychology. It also opened the door to a life of greater authenticity, possibility and joy.

Living overseas and her passion for travel played a significant role in shaping Mariah’s perspective. Experiencing different cultures and ways of thinking encouraged her to question long-held beliefs, embrace uncertainty and remain open to new ideas.

Through The Choice, Mariah hopes to create a space where people are inspired by the stories they hear, recognise their power to create change in their own lives, and discover that there can be greater joy and fulfilment on the other side of life’s hardest choices.
